ARC EM Starter Kit

Overview

The DesignWare® ARC® EM Starter Kit is a low-cost, versatile solution enabling rapid software development, software debugging, and profiling for the ARC EM Family of processors, including the EM4, EM6, EM5D, EM7D, EM9D and EM11D cores. The ARC EM Starter Kit consists of a hardware platform, including pre-installed FPGA images of different ARC EM processor configurations with peripherals. A comprehensive suite of free and open source software is available from the https://embARC.org website for use with the board. Over fifty example applications are included to help get started quickly with developing software for ARC EM processors.

The development board is based on a Xilinx Spartan®-6 LX150 FPGA and supports a variety of hardware extensions via six 2x6 connectors supporting a total of 48 user I/O pins (plus power and ground pins) that can be used to connect components such as sensors, actuators, memories, displays, buttons, switches, and communication devices. A Digilent Pmod™ Compatible extension board containing a 4-channel 12-bit A/D converter with an I2C interface and an AC power adapter is included in the package.

ARC EM Starter Kit includes the following features:

  • Closely Coupled Memory for instructions and for data
  • 128 MByte DDR3 RAM
  • Six connectors for hardware extensions
  • Flexible selection of UART, SPI, I2C and GPIO peripherals
  • JTAG and serial console over USB
  • Standard 20-pin JTAG connector also supporting 4-wire JTAG for ARC EM processor
  • 8 Mbyte for application software available in on-board flash
  • SD-card for additional application software and data storage

Connecting to the Serial Terminal

Warning

On Linux machines it may be necessary for a user to be in dialout group to successfully connect to a serial terminal. In case of "Permission denied" error try to add a user to the group:

sudo usermod -aG dialout username

Connecting to the board using USB data port allows to connect to the serial terminal over UART. You need to configure these parameters of a serial terminal to interact with the serial port:

  • baud-rate 115200
  • 8 data bits
  • 1 stop Bit

On Windows Putty or any similar software may be used for connecting to the serial terminal. You can find the port number in Device Manager in Ports (COM & LPT) section: USB Serial Port (COMx) where COMx is a value for Serial line field in Putty's. Other parameters may be set Connection → Serial menu.

On Linux minicom or other similar utilities may be used. Here is an example of command line for minicom:

minicom -8 -b 115200 -D /dev/ttyUSB1
